Xtorris Posted February 19, 2021 Share Posted February 19, 2021 11 minutes ago, T-O-A said: Each position of the castle swith is one weapon? like... up is gun, left is SW, right is SP and down is PH? Does it have a push function? Yes. The options are as follows: LR Selects Phoenix missiles. MR Selects Sparrow missiles. SR Selects Sidewinder missiles. GN Selects gun 4 minutes ago, Moorhuhn said: That was quick From where did you get this stick?
